Seven former fraternity members in court today. the mom who had talked to her son before he went to that initiation ritual, she and her husband coming face-to-face for those blamed in the alcohol-related death of their own son. here s stephanie ramos. reporter: tonight, the seven former members of pi kappa alpha fraternity are all pleading not guilty to all charges in connection with the death of 20-year-old bowling green state university sophomore stone foltz. foltz died of alcohol poisoning three days after the fraternity allegedly held an initiation event in which foltz and other incoming members were encouraged to drink an entire bottle of hard liquor each. stone s family fighting for justice, remembering a phone call right before that initiation. he said, it s just part of the ritual, i have to. but i don t want to. court will call state of ohio versus jacob krinn. reporter: prosecutors say he was brought home by other members, including jacob krinn, stone s fraternity big ....
